日志文件說明
Nova日志
OpenStack計算服務日志位於/var/log/nova目錄下(此目錄在Controller和Compute節點都存在),默認權限擁有者是nova用戶
文件名 | 作用 |
---|---|
nova-compute.log | 虛擬機實例在啟動和運行中產生的日志 |
nova-network.log | 關於網絡狀態、分配、路由和安全組的日志 |
nova-manage.log | 運行nova-manage命令時產生的日志 |
nova-scheduler.log | 關於調度服務的相關日志 |
nova-objectstore.log | 鏡像相關日志 |
nova-api.log | 用戶與OpenStack交互以及OpenStack組件交互的消息相關日志 |
nova-cert.log | - |
nova-console.log | 關於VNC服務的詳細信息 |
nova-consoleauth.log | 關於VNC服務的認證信息 |
nova-dhcpbridge.log | - |
Dashboard日志
dashboard日志位於/var/log/apache2/目錄下
Cinder日志
對象存儲swift默認日志寫到syslog中(/var/log/syslog、/var/log/messages),cinder日志默認位於/var/log/cinder目錄下
文件名 | 作用 |
---|---|
cinder-api.log | 用戶與OpenStack交互以及OpenStack組件交互的消息相關日志 |
cinder-scheduler.log | 關於調度服務的相關日志 |
cinder-volume.log | 卷服務相關日志 |
Keystone日志
keystone服務日志位於/var/log/keystone目錄下
Glance日志
glance服務日志位於/var/log/glance目錄下
文件名 | 作用 |
---|---|
api.log | 用戶與OpenStack交互以及OpenStack組件交互的消息相關日志 |
registry.log | 鏡像注冊服務相關的日志 |
Neutron日志
neutron服務日志位於/var/log/neutron目錄下
文件名 | 作用 |
---|---|
dhcp-agent.log | dhcp服務相關日志 |
l3-agent.log | L3代理相關日志 |
openvswitch-agent.log | openvswitch相關操作日志 |
metadata-agent.log | neutron代理傳輸給nova的元數據服務相關日志 |
server.log | 用戶與OpenStack交互以及OpenStack組件交互的消息相關日志 |
日志格式說明
時間戳 | 日志等級 | 代碼模塊 | Request ID | 日志內容 | 源代碼位置 |
---|---|---|---|---|---|
日志記錄的時間 | INFO/WARNING/ERROR/DEBUG | python模塊名 | 請求標識 | - | - |
日志剖析
Neutron-server日志
第一部分:啟動服務
### 輸出服務啟動命令
INFO neutron.common.config [-] Logging enabled!
neutron.common.config XXX
第二部分:加載ml2插件
### 加載ml2_conf.ini的配置項
INFO neutron.manager [-] Loading core plugin: ml2
INFO neutron.plugins.ml2.plugin [-] Modular L2 Plugin initialization complete
neutron.manager XXX
neutron.plugins.ml2.* XXX
networking_ovn.ml2.* XXX
第三部分:加載服務插件
neutron.manager [-] Loading service plugins: XXX
neutron.manager [-] Loading Plugin: XXX
neutron.manager [-] Successfully loaded XXX
第四部分:加載擴展API
neutron.api.extensions XXX
第五部分:打印參數選項
oslo_service.service [-] XXX = XXX
neutron.wsgi [-] XXX = XXX
第六部分:OVN數據庫同步
networking_ovn.ovn_db_sync XXX
第七部分:執行命令
neutron.api.v2.base [-] Request body: XXX
neutron.api.rpc XXX
Neutron-l3-agent日志
第一部分:啟動服務
INFO neutron.common.config [-] Logging enabled!
neutron.common.config [-] XXX
第二部分:加載擴展插件
INFO neutron.agent.agent_extensions_manager [-] Loaded agent extensions: []
neutron.agent.agent_extensions_manager XXX
第三部分:打印參數選項
oslo_service.service [-] XXX = XXX
neutron.wsgi [-] XXX = XXX
第四部分:執行命令
INFO neutron.agent.l3.agent [-] L3 agent started
neutron.agent.l3.agent XXX